Microphone sensitivity adjust <When hands free unit connecting>
Adjusting the volume of the Microphone. Display and Setting "HF MIC ADJ:00" "HF MIC ADJ:15" (Original setting) "HF MIC ADJ:31"
Touch Sensor Tone
Setting the operation check sound (beep sound) ON/OFF. Display "Beep:ON" "Beep:OFF" Setting Beep is heard. Beep canceled.

Auto Response time Adjust <When hands free unit connecting>
Setting the time from an incoming call to the automatic response. Display and Setting "Wait Time:OFF" "Wait Time: 1S" "Wait Time: 5S" (Original setting) "Wait Time:30S"
If the time set in the GSM telephone is shorter than that set in the unit, the former will be used.
